This superb miniature is one of the most dramatic Erongo Aquamarines I have yet handled. It is a complete-all-around, perfect, spray of well-balanced crystals. They have robust color and an unusually fine gemminess, and internal brightness, to them. The tips are all pristine, and very slightly included with a dusting of schorl which offsets them nicely.
